The 1.2 billion dollar mixed use project in Buckhead called The Streets of Buckhead, should begin the teardown phase of its construction in October. Eight blocks will be demolished to build this project which will feature 500,000 square feet of retail and restaurant space, four world class hotels, up to 1,000 luxury residential units and [...]

A 123,542 square foot, mixed use development, is planned for the corner of Dresden Drive and Caldwell Road in Brookhaven. The project will be called Village Place Brookhaven and has already received $19 million in funding.
Village Place Brookhaven will sit across the street from Brookhaven Park Place and its 2 buildings will consist of retail [...]

Preliminary plans have been given to the city for Buckhead Avenues, a $160 million mixed use development in the heart of Buckhead. The seven acre site will contain 800,000 square feet of retail space , office space, residential and restaurant space.
There is no date set for the groundbreaking, but completion is expected in 2009.

Three developers with local ties are planning to redevelop the area around Marta’s Five Points station. The redeveloped area will be called Railroad District, as a symbol of the first business corridor and hotel row in Atlanta’s history. The plans call for nearly 1,000 new lofts and an undetermined amount of new retail space. The [...]

Novare Group just spent $40 million for a nine acre parcel within Buckhead Village to build a mixed use development. The project is going to take at least 7 years due to current tenant relationships, but when it’s finished will consist of retail space, office space and luxury condos.
The project is located at the southeast [...]
